I've been inching towards having a fiberglass pool installed in Southern Ontario. I've found one PB who I like and who has good references. He didn't feel that the pool would need to be bonded as there are no rails/metal parts/etc. But he also said bonding is more of an electrician function and gave me the phone number of the electrician who he works with on his pool installs.

I sent snippets of articles i found online regarding bonding of fiberglass pools, and his response is posted below. Given that I know nothing about pools, bonding and electricity, I'm sharing the electricians response back, and hoping you guys can provide your thoughts/feedback? TIA!
_____________
I’ve read through them all (referring to the links I sent him). I think the point they’re trying to make is that the water could carry a charge that differs from earth. I just disagree with how they try to explain that

For the water to be charged and not ground out you would have to have zero connection to ground. The link from Seabreeze explains that. But we do ground out the pump, salter, heater, rebar and anything metal. Water is in direct contact with the pump and heater. So unless you had all plastic parts I’m certain the water couldn’t carry a charge

I guess if you look at it like that, we are essentially grounding a fiber pool. Just not the same way as a metal. With a metal pool we physically ground the pool wall. Not because the water could be charged, but because the pool wall could be charged. But that’s impossible with a fiber pool. It’s non-conductive. Either way, the water is already at a potential equal to the equipment and earth, ideally 0 volts

That’s my take on it anyways. As I mentioned, I think if it would make you feel better, maybe adding the skimmer bonding lug is something we should consider for your application. I don’t think it would cost very much for the peace of mind

I was wondering, if i test with a voltmeter(?) after he bonds, and it reads zero - is it safe to assume it is properly bonded? Or should I constantly test?
 
I was wondering, if i test with a voltmeter(?) after he bonds, and it reads zero - is it safe to assume it is properly bonded? Or should I constantly test?

Not necessarily, as if there is no fault as such then a voltmeter will read zero anyway.

It is not until a fault presents itself where correct bonding then prevents a voltage differential from occurring.

The correct way to test bonding is with a proper earth/insulation type tester where it can measure low and high resistance paths accurately. Measuring low resistance can be a bit hit and miss with cheap mutimeters.

Bonding requirements vary - here in one of our states (QLD - Australia) electrical bonding is not required for fibreglass pools unless there are metal objects within 2m or so of the pool or metal objects that make contact with the water eg: steps/rails etc.

From a purely electrical perspective - bonding of rebar is not much use for a fibreglass pool (which has no metal components) as it is effectively insulated from the water, in a gunite pool it is a different matter. IMO - Bonding of the water itself in a FG pool is of much more importance.

These days, carefully selected pool components such as low voltage LED lighting, double insulated pumps etc reduce the risk of electric shock.

Many people have been killed simply due to faulty/corroded light fixtures over the years - Thankfully some (most?) LED lights these days run off low voltage DC which reduce the risk substantially.

I did all the research for my Ontario Canada build a year ago. Anything metal must be bonded. Stainless steel hand rail or ladder, Aluminim coping etc. If there is positively no metal that can be touched from inside the pool, bonding is not required but just because it is not required doesn’t mean it shouldn’t be done. If nothing else, bond the water with something like the bondsafe 680. If you use steel in your concrete, it should be bonded.
